TURN-208: Gatevale turnstile counters at the Merrow Field pilot double-count when a rotation reverses mid-cycle. Attendance totals drift roughly 2% high per event. The debounce window fix is implemented, reviewed by Ilsa, and soak-tested across two simulated match days without drift. Ready for your cut; the candidate build is identified below.

trace token, tagag-tafog: htk6_5ed18c

## Flaky DNS on the Quillbarn cluster

If lookups for internal services start timing out randomly, don't restart the app first — it's almost always the resolver cache going stale after a node reboot. Flush it, wait thirty seconds, retest. If it recurs twice in an hour, page platform. The resolver settings currently in effect are these.

deployment values, kaweg-yajeg:
[zorvan]
port = 8080
region = west-4
host = zorvan.merlaqcloud.local
team = istael
timeout_ms = 500
retries = 8

Welcome to the Marlowe support rotation! Quick note on fonts: we never link out to font vendors — everything is vendored into the Glyphbin package, licenses and all. So if a customer reports missing characters, it's a caching thing, not a vendor outage. The full explainer, including escalation steps, lives on the page below.

dashboard of yahaf-kajep = https://jira.zemvarsys.internal/display/projects/browse/browse/a08b

## Authentication

The Corvette Catalog service invalidates cached product entries whenever a SKU mutation lands, so stale reads should never exceed one replication cycle. Manual cache purges go through the admin endpoint, which requires authenticated requests. For local development against the shared staging cluster, include the bearer token shown below in every purge request.

portal login ticket: eyJhbGciOiJIUzI1NiIsInR5cCI6IkpXVCJ9.eyJzdWIiOiIwEOsktwVNwIn0.-UJU3fdyyCgG

Hi support folks — quick context so you can answer customer questions. We're mid-migration splitting the Oakmere user-profile store into four shards, and the credentials vault for shard C auto-locked after the migration job restarted too many times. Profiles on that shard are read-only until it's reopened, so edits to display names and avatars will fail with a 503. No data is lost. Whoever picks this up should reopen the vault from the ops console using the recovery passphrase provided below.

strongbox words: norwyn-wenael-aldvan-aldiel-wendor-holael